St. Maria is an Evangelical Lutheran church in Pohja in Finland .

history

The Church of St. Maria in Pohja was built between 1460 and 1480. Most of the work was carried out by local residents under the guidance of foreign experts.

In the Great Northern War (1713–1721) the church lost all furnishings that had not previously been transported or hidden. The repairs took 100 years. The construction of the bell tower in 1827 marked the end of this period.

Furnishing

Over the centuries the church has acquired a multitude of items. In the 19th century, the church was adapted to the Empire style , which shaped it until the 1950s. The altar and pulpit were white, and the pulpit was on the south wall. The windows, the organ prospect and the entire furnishings were changed in favor of simplicity and symmetry.

In the 1950s, the church received its current appearance. The pulpit is back in its old place, the stained glass has replaced the altarpiece, and the altar barrier has been renewed.

  • Votive ship : built by local resident Karl Immonen and donated to the church in 1991; The model is the ship " Coldin "
  • The pulpit was made in Ekenäs in the 17th century based on foreign models . From 1848 to 1951 it was in a storage room. Then it was restored by the woodcarver Axel Lindström , a local resident. Today it is back in its previous place.
  • The patron saint, the Virgin Mary, is the oldest item in the church. Strictly and solemnly she holds the baby Jesus in her arms. The wooden sculpture dates from the 14th century and still bears traces of white, blue, red, silver and gold.
  • Pietà - Versperbild from the 15th century
  • The stained glass of the altar window was made by Kitty Liljequist-Krogius in 1955. It depicts the Sermon on the Mount and the parable of the Good Samaritan in the upper part.
  • Organ from 1862 by Per Larsson Åkerman
